RIVERA v. NEWTON, 413 S.C. 26 (2015)

Court: Supreme Court of South Carolina Number: inscco20150701879 Visitors: 5
Filed: Jul. 01, 2015
Latest Update: Jul. 01, 2015
Summary: PER CURIAM . We granted certiorari to review the court of appeals' opinion in Rivera v. Newton, 401 S.C. 402 , 737 S.E.2d 193 (Ct.App. 2012). We now dismiss the writ of certiorari as improvidently granted and further direct the court of appeals to depublish its opinion and assign the matter an unpublished opinion number. The above opinion shall no longer have any precedential effect. DISMISSED AS IMPROVIDENTLY GRANTED.
